Dr. Sarah Booth is Director of the Jean Mayer USDA Human Nutrition Research Center on Aging at Tufts University (HNRCA) and Senior Scientist and also leads all research projects focused on diet and the aging brain and sensory systems. There's a lot of hype about the benefits of studying STEM subjects, but savvy students realize that no college degree assures career success , and biology … WebA-5: Understand the sensory and motor changes associated with aging and how they lead to decreased function and increased risk of morbidity. Mobility changes in the aging adult can result from changes in gait, balance, and physical strength, and can negatively influence the number and severity of falls, social participation, and independence.
